Handicap Ramp Repair in Olathe, KS
Handicap ramp repair services focus on restoring and maintaining accessibility features on residential properties. These projects typically involve fixing or upgrading existing ramps to ensure they remain safe, stable, and compliant with accessibility standards. Property owners often request repairs for issues such as loose handrails, damaged surfaces, uneven surfaces, or structural instability that can hinder safe use. Understanding the scope of the repair work needed, the materials involved, and the current condition of the ramp helps homeowners determine whether a repair is sufficient or if a replacement might be necessary.
Before requesting handicap ramp repairs, property owners should assess the specific problems affecting the ramp’s safety and usability. It's helpful to know the age of the existing ramp, the type of damage or wear present, and any local building codes or accessibility guidelines that may apply. Clear communication about the current condition and desired outcomes can assist in planning effective repairs that enhance safety and functionality. Proper evaluation ensures that repairs address all critical issues, providing continued access and peace of mind for residents and visitors.

Common Handicap Ramp Repair Jobs
Handicap Ramp Repair - restores safety and accessibility for wheelchair users and those with mobility challenges.
Ramp reinforcement - stabilizes existing ramps to prevent wobbling and structural failure.
Surface repairs - fixes cracks, holes, and uneven surfaces for smooth, secure footing.
Frame and support replacement - updates worn or damaged support structures for reliable use.
Slope adjustments - ensures ramps meet proper incline standards for safe navigation.
Material upgrades - replaces aging components with durable, weather-resistant materials.
Handicap Ramp Repair Questions
What types of damage require ramp repair? Common issues include rust, corrosion, loose fittings, and surface wear that can affect stability and safety.
How can I tell if my handicap ramp needs repairs? Signs include wobbling, uneven surfaces, cracks, or difficulty supporting weight safely.
Are there specific materials best suited for ramp repairs? Durable materials like treated wood, aluminum, or composite are often used for long-lasting repairs.
What benefits come from repairing a handicap ramp? Repairs improve safety, accessibility, and compliance, helping to ensure safe entry for all users.
